你查询的IP:[125.62.139.90]  地理位置:印度

最新查询119.128.78.24 124.200.254.56 121.59.140.244 124.68.96.43 117.80.211.202 124.29.101.122 121.56.48.178 119.2.56.178 168.160.51.41 125.62.139.90 124.108.40.30 203.118.192.253 116.198.6.133 121.52.208.224 121.40.33.103 119.128.190.178 202.92.48.191 202.136.208.197 116.8.140.7 122.152.192.240 202.70.110.176 222.176.116.3 124.254.150.103 220.232.64.16 117.24.193.122 123.177.159.211 222.126.128.254 116.90.184.22 124.224.44.3 202.95.252.7 125.112.103.133